Conditions

Chronic diseases, particularly cardiovascular disease and cancers Nutritional, Metabolic, Endocrine

Interventions

1. Test-meal 1: 50 g wheat aleurone incorporated into a bread roll 2. Test-meal 2: 50 g wheat aleurone + 5.2 mg iron incorporated into a bread roll 3. Control-meal: 50 g refined wheat product incorpor

Inclusion criteria

Inclusion criteria: Healthy 18 - 40 year old men and women with Body Mass Index (BMI) between 18 and 30 kg/m^2.

Exclusion criteria

Exclusion criteria: 1. Smokers 2. Individuals with diabetes 3. Pre-existing chronic disease 4. On any prescription medicine 5. Individuals who regularly take any vitamin or mineral supplement or did so in the 6 months prior to the study 6. Gluten or wheat intolerant individuals 7. Pregnant or lactating women 8. Individuals who have given blood to the Blood Transfusion Service (BTS) in the 4 months prior to the study

Design outcomes

Primary

MeasureTime frame
1. Changes in plasma betaine, choline, folate, tocopherols and ferulic acid attributable to treatments, measured at baseline, 0.5 hours, 1 hour, 2 hours and 3 hours post-meal 2. Changes in urinary ferulic acid attributable to treatments, measured at baseline, 0.5 hours, 1 hour, 2 hours, 3 hours and 4 hours post-meal

Secondary

MeasureTime frame
1. Changes in plasma antioxidant activity attributable to treatments, measured at baseline, 0.5 hours, 1 hour, 2 hours and 3 hours post-meal 2. Changes in urinary antioxidant activity and phenolic activity attributable to treatments, measured at baseline, 0.5 hours, 1 hour, 2 hours, 3 hours and 4 hours post-meal 3. Evaluation of the effects of processing, including iron fortification, on the availability of the bioactive components in wheat fractions, using test-meal 2 and comparisons with previous work
